The STM32F777VIH6 runs at 216 MHz with 2 MB Flash and 512 KB SRAM.
Peripheral set — Ethernet, CAN, USB OTG on one chip
This part integrates Ethernet MAC, two CAN interfaces, USB OTG (FS/HS), plus a bank of UARTs, SPIs, I²Cs, and an S/PDIF receiver. The EBI/EMI interface can connect external SRAM, NOR Flash, or a camera sensor. For audio or waveform output, there are two 12-bit DACs and a 16-channel 12-bit ADC. The QSPI interface allows memory-mapped access to external serial Flash at high speed. That peripheral density means a single STM32F777VIH6 can replace a multi-chip architecture in a gateway or data concentrator design.
Package and footprint — 100-TFBGA
The 82 GPIOs are enough for a parallel LCD, external memory bus, and sensor array without a port expander. Surface-mount only — the BGA requires x-ray inspection for solder-joint verification.
